Shaft Wall Requirements for Tall Mass Timber Buildings

Expert Tips

Architects & Engineers

In-depth technical guide examining shaft enclosure requirements for the three new tall mass timber construction types (IV-A, IV-B, IV-C) introduced in the 2021 IBC. Covers comprehensive analysis of allowable materials, noncombustible protection requirements, fire-resistance ratings, and other design considerations for stairs, elevators, and MEP chases in multi-story buildings. Addresses specific requirements for mass timber use in shaft walls, protection time calculations, contribution to FRR through combination of timber charring and noncombustible protection, and detailed construction specifications. Includes practical guidance on detailing floor-to-shaft and roof-to-shaft wall intersections, with consideration of structural loads, acoustics, and fire barrier continuity.
